ICRI launches certificate course in clinical research for nurses

Our Bureau, BangaloreThursday, September 20, 2007, 08:00 Hrs  [IST]

Institute of Clinical Research (India), ICRI, India's premier institution in clinical research studies, has launched a new course, Certificate Course in Clinical Research for Nurses, which is a part time course with a duration of six months. With India becoming a signatory to TRIPS, clinical trials being mandatory to be conducted as per ICH GCP norms, new career opportunities are available for thousands in the field of clinical research. Certificate in Clinical Research for Nurses offered by ICRI is one among the various career opportunities available these days. The teaching methodologies and experienced faculty at ICRI are instrumental in giving the industry clinical research professionals who are competent to take up responsible tasks within the industry. Nurses who qualify in clinical research can look forward to rewarding careers as clinical research associates, clinical research executives, clinical trial assistant, research nurses, project managers and site managers, stated ICRI sources. The contents are Module I_ which covers Introduction to Pharmaceutical Medicine & Drug Development Process, Module II_ Basic Principles of Clinical Research, Module III_ Good Clinical Practices: ICH-GCP Guidelines, Module IV_ Roles and Responsibilities of a Clinical Trial Personnel, Module V_Regulations in Clinical Research and Module VI_ Bioethics for Protection of human subject in Clinical Research.
